Location is everything! Nestled in one of Maldon’s most sought-after spots, this detached family home backs directly onto the River Chelmer and is on the market for the first time since it was built.

Tucked away down a charming lane with just a handful of properties, yet only a short distance from the High Street, homes like this are truly a rare find. A reluctant family sale means this is your opportunity to own something really special.

Offering bright and spacious accommodation throughout, this well-maintained and much-loved home was built with a high specification for its time and now awaits the new owners to put their stamp upon a property that will be a happy home for many years. Built as a four bedroom and adapted to create a large landing with sitting / study area, the property now offers three bedrooms, plus a study. With a huge en-suite to the principal bedroom along with river views offered from two of the bedrooms and the extended landing.

The property sits upon a generous plot of approximately 80ft in width. The rear garden is mainly lawned with the bottom section, leading down to the water, being a bit more of a nature haven. This area is fenced from the main garden and was utilised by the family to keep a boat, and the neighbouring property has a similar area with use of a small wooden jetty, which also may be a possibility for the subject house (STP).
